Expansion: Norvale Region (Managers Only)

This page outlines our entry into the Norvale corridor for the sales leads. Market sizing suggests strong demand for the Averix line among mid-tier distributors. A regional hub opens in Castelmark next spring, with two account teams hired locally. Pricing follows the standard tiered model with a temporary introductory discount. Coordinate territory splits with your counterparts before kickoff. The sensitive planning note appears directly below.

internal memo for kawip-hadug: Headcount on the Wenwyn team goes from 7 to 140 by the end of January. Gross margin on Wenwyn came in at 20 percent against a plan of 15 percent.

# Vendored fonts policy — please read before editing.
# All third-party typefaces used by the Lanternwell UI are vendored
# into /assets/fonts with their license files alongside; never pull
# fonts from a remote host at runtime. The font manifest records each
# family's version, checksum, and license status, and the build step
# validates the manifest against the asset-tracking database. To run
# that validation locally, connect using the connection string below.

replica DSN, kajep-yahag: mssql://praok_svc:iF@db-8d68.plorvaio.local:5432/eliion

## Partner SFTP Drop — Overview

Each night around 02:00, Harlowe Freight uploads manifest files to our SFTP landing zone. The ingest job picks them up within fifteen minutes and records each file's checksum and row count. If a partner reports a missing manifest, check the ingest log table first. That table lives in the intake database, reachable with the connection string below.

primary connection of yagep-kahip = redis://giliel_svc:zYiKsLL2PLpfPL@db-348f.xolmarsys.corp:5432/fenwyn